    The only thing it does, it seems, is to readjust the accelerator feed so that when it is pressed half-way, it fools the computer to think it's pressed all the way. I guess it does give you an illusion of power, but no actual power. For the price, I would rather spend it on something like Bully Dog that actually increase performance.

    I have a similar thing on My Vette. It remaps the accelerator to make it more sensitive. When you first put it on your vehicle, it seems to make your car accelerate faster. However, your muscle memory eventually relearns the sensitivity, and the initial thrill fades quickly thereafter.
